Bab Al-Yemen Boston مطعم باب اليمن بوسطن is a restaurant located in Boston, MA. It is one of 1,950 restaurants listed in Boston. Its 4.8-star rating is above the Boston city average of 4.2 stars. There are 10 photos associated with this location.

About Bab Al-Yemen Boston مطعم باب اليمن بوسطن

This is a Yemeni cuisine restaurant which serves Yemen authentic food. This is the first of its kind in New England

Bab Al-Yemen in Boston is a gem. My husband took me there for my birthday dinner, and we loved it so much that we went back again with family and friends. We tried the chicken mandi, mathbi chicken, falafel over rice, chicken and veggie stews, and finished with the dessert Fattah Tamr—everything was flavorful and delicious. I especially loved the traditional floor seating, which made the experience feel warm and authentic. Highly recommend!

My dad and I came here for an early afternoon lunch. We enjoyed the Yemeni Cocktail with a delicious sweet accompaniment to our meal. We started with the Mutabal with pita and Veggie Samboosa. For our main dish we enjoy the Lamb Haneeth. I recommend getting a side of Marak and Sahawek to have along side any started or entree. All delicious and flavorful. Our darling waitress offered us both Mint and Adani tea to finish off our meals. We really enjoyed our time here and would come again.

Generally I think this place has been overhyped. We got their lamb hummus, fahsa, and maasoob. Food is slightly under seasoned compared to Yemeni dishes I’ve had; and I expected the maasoob to be more aromatic. The flat bread is good and the hummus is creamy and balanced. The staff are friendly and the restaurant is well maintained.
